Hypnosis
A trance-like state of focused attention and increased suggestibility, often used for therapeutic purposes.
Fantasy
An imaginative or fanciful thought, not grounded in reality, often serving as a mental escape from mundane or stressful scenarios.
I.Q.
Short for Intelligence Quotient, a measure of a person's intellectual abilities relative to their age group.
Brain Waves
The patterns of electrical activity in the brain, measured by EEG, that are indicative of different states of consciousness.
